当前位置: 首页 > 专利查询>鹏城实验室专利>正文

资产探测方法、装置、终端设备以及计算机可读存储介质制造方法及图纸

技术编号:29593989 阅读:23 留言:0更新日期:2021-08-06 19:55
本发明专利技术公开一种资产探测方法,所述方法包括以下步骤:在接收到探测指令时,基于所述探测指令,获取目标拓扑结构中各节点的实时镜像标识;将所述实时镜像标识划分为已知镜像标识和未知镜像标识;从预设镜像列表中获取已知节点的第一资产数据,所述已知节点为所述目标拓扑结构中与所述已知镜像标识对应的节点;对所述未知镜像标识对应的未知节点进行资产探测,以获得第二资产数据;基于所述第一资产数据和所述第二资产数据,获得所述目标拓扑结构的结果资产数据。本发明专利技术还公开了一种资产探测装置、终端设备以及计算机可读存储介质。利用本发明专利技术的资产探测方法,达到了提高资产探测效率的技术效果。

【技术实现步骤摘要】
资产探测方法、装置、终端设备以及计算机可读存储介质
本专利技术涉及资产管理
,特别涉及一种资产探测方法、装置、终端设备以及计算机可读存储介质。
技术介绍
网络仿真平台态势感知技术是指对在网络仿真平台上进行的实验过程进行态势感知的技术,网络仿真平台态势感知技术包括数据采集、态势分析和数据展示等。在网络仿真平台态势感知技术中,需要对资产进行探测;通过资产探测设备(终端设备)对目标网络中的主机信息、网络设备节点信息、安全设备节点信息、各设备的应用软件的类型、各设备的应用软件的版本型号、各设备的操作系统、各设备的操作系统的本号等进行探测,获得探测结果,并把探测结果作为态势分析的基础数据。目前,资产探测方法主要是基于软件或者硬件的探测方法,例如namp扫描和Masscan扫描。但是,采用现有的资产探测方法,资产探测速度较慢,导致获得探测结果的效率较低。
技术实现思路
本专利技术的主要目的是提供一种资产探测方法、装置、终端设备以及计算机可读存储介质,旨在解决现有技术中资产探测速度较慢,导致获得探测结果的效率较低的技术问题。为实现上述目的,本专利技术提出一种资产探测方法,所述方法包括以下步骤:在接收到探测指令时,基于所述探测指令,获取目标拓扑结构中各节点的实时镜像标识;将所述实时镜像标识划分为已知镜像标识和未知镜像标识;从预设镜像列表中获取已知节点的第一资产数据,所述已知节点为所述目标拓扑结构中与所述已知镜像标识对应的节点;对所述未知镜像标识对应的未知节点进行资产探测,以获得第二资产数据;基于所述第一资产数据和所述第二资产数据,获得所述目标拓扑结构的结果资产数据。可选的,所述将所述实时镜像标识划分为已知镜像标识和未知镜像标识的步骤包括:利用所述预设镜像列表,将所述实时镜像标识划分为已知镜像标识和未知镜像标识。可选的,所述预设镜像列表包括预设镜像标识;所述利用所述预设镜像列表,将所述实时镜像标识划分为已知镜像标识和未知镜像标识的步骤包括:将所述实时镜像标识中与所述预设镜像标识匹配的镜像标识确定为所述已知镜像标识;将所述实时镜像标识中与所述预设镜像标识不匹配的镜像标识确定为所述未知镜像标识。可选的,所述预设镜像列表还包括所述预设镜像标识对应的预设资产数据;所述从预设镜像列表中获取已知节点的第一资产数据的步骤包括:在所述预设镜像列表中确定出与所述已知镜像标识匹配的选定预设镜像标识;从所述预设镜像列表获取与所述选定预设镜像标识对应的选定预设资产数据;基于所述选定预设资产数据,获得所述第一资产数据。可选的,所述对所述未知镜像标识对应的未知节点进行资产探测,以获得第二资产数据的步骤之后,所述方法还包括:建立所述未知镜像标识与所述第二资产数据的映射关系;利用所述未知镜像标识和所述第二资产数据,对所述预设镜像列表进行更新,以获得更新后的预设镜像列表。可选的,所述在接收到探测指令时,基于所述探测指令,获取目标拓扑结构中各节点的实时镜像标识的步骤包括:在接收到探测指令时,基于所述探测指令,获取所述目标拓扑结构的目标拓扑数据;从所述目标拓扑数据中获取所述实时镜像标识。可选的,所述基于所述第一资产数据和所述第二资产数据,获得所述目标拓扑结构的结果资产数据的步骤之后,所述方法还包括:对所述结果资产数据进行态势分析,以获得所述目标拓扑结构的态势分析结果;输出所述态势分析结果。此外,为实现上述目的,本专利技术还提出了一种资产探测装置,所述装置包括:接收模块,用于在接收到探测指令时,基于所述探测指令,获取目标拓扑结构中各节点的实时镜像标识;划分模块,用于将所述实时镜像标识划分为已知镜像标识和未知镜像标识;确定模块,用于从预设镜像列表中获取已知节点的第一资产数据,所述已知节点为所述目标拓扑结构中与所述已知镜像标识对应的节点;探测模块,用于对所述未知镜像标识对应的未知节点进行资产探测,以获得第二资产数据;获得模块,用于基于所述第一资产数据和所述第二资产数据,获得所述目标拓扑结构的结果资产数据。此外,为实现上述目的,本专利技术还提出了一种终端设备,所述终端设备包括:存储器、处理器及存储在所述存储器上并在所述处理器上运行资产探测程序,所述资产探测程序被所述处理器执行时实现如上述任一项所述的资产探测方法的步骤。此外,为实现上述目的,本专利技术还提出了一种计算机可读存储介质,所述计算机可读存储介质上存储有资产探测程序,所述资产探测程序被处理器执行时实现如上述任一项所述的资产探测方法的步骤。本专利技术技术方案提出了一种资产探测方法,通过在接收到探测指令时,基于所述探测指令,获取目标拓扑结构中各节点的实时镜像标识;将所述实时镜像标识划分为已知镜像标识和未知镜像标识;从预设镜像列表中获取已知节点的第一资产数据,所述已知节点为所述目标拓扑结构中与所述已知镜像标识对应的节点;对所述未知镜像标识对应的未知节点进行资产探测,以获得第二资产数据;基于所述第一资产数据和所述第二资产数据,获得所述目标拓扑结构的结果资产数据。现有的资产探测方法,在接收到探测指令时,对目标拓扑结构中各节点分别进行探测,以获得各节点的资产数据,并基于各节点的资产数据获得目标拓扑结构的资产数据;而本专利技术,只需要对未知镜像标识对应的未知节点进行资产探测,以获得第二资产数据,同时,直接从所述预设镜像列表中获取已知节点的第一资产数据,并基于所述第一资产数据和第二资产数据,获得所述目标拓扑结构的结果资产数据,并不需要对已知节点进行资产探测,减少了资产探测的节点数量,资产探测速度较快,所以,利用本专利技术的资产探测方法,达到了提高资产探测效率的技术效果。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图示出的结构获得其他的附图。图1为本专利技术实施例方案涉及的硬件运行环境的终端设备结构示意图;图2为本专利技术资产探测方法第一实施例的流程示意图;图3为本专利技术资产探测装置第一实施例的结构框图。本专利技术目的的实现、功能特点及优点将结合实施例,参照附图做进一步说明。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术的一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。参照图1,图1为本专利技术实施例方案涉及的硬件运行环境的终端设备结构示意图。终端设备可以是移动电话、智能电话、笔记本电脑、数字广播接收器、个人数字助理(PDA)、平板电脑(PAD)等用本文档来自技高网...

【技术保护点】
1.一种资产探测方法,其特征在于,所述方法包括以下步骤:/n在接收到探测指令时,基于所述探测指令,获取目标拓扑结构中各节点的实时镜像标识;/n将所述实时镜像标识划分为已知镜像标识和未知镜像标识;/n从预设镜像列表中获取已知节点的第一资产数据,所述已知节点为所述目标拓扑结构中与所述已知镜像标识对应的节点;/n对所述未知镜像标识对应的未知节点进行资产探测,以获得第二资产数据;/n基于所述第一资产数据和所述第二资产数据,获得所述目标拓扑结构的结果资产数据。/n

【技术特征摘要】
1.一种资产探测方法,其特征在于,所述方法包括以下步骤:
在接收到探测指令时,基于所述探测指令,获取目标拓扑结构中各节点的实时镜像标识;
将所述实时镜像标识划分为已知镜像标识和未知镜像标识;
从预设镜像列表中获取已知节点的第一资产数据,所述已知节点为所述目标拓扑结构中与所述已知镜像标识对应的节点;
对所述未知镜像标识对应的未知节点进行资产探测,以获得第二资产数据;
基于所述第一资产数据和所述第二资产数据,获得所述目标拓扑结构的结果资产数据。


2.如权利要求1所述的方法,其特征在于,所述将所述实时镜像标识划分为已知镜像标识和未知镜像标识的步骤包括:
利用所述预设镜像列表,将所述实时镜像标识划分为已知镜像标识和未知镜像标识。


3.如权利要求2所述的方法,其特征在于,所述预设镜像列表包括预设镜像标识;所述利用所述预设镜像列表,将所述实时镜像标识划分为已知镜像标识和未知镜像标识的步骤包括:
将所述实时镜像标识中与所述预设镜像标识匹配的镜像标识确定为所述已知镜像标识;
将所述实时镜像标识中与所述预设镜像标识不匹配的镜像标识确定为所述未知镜像标识。


4.如权利要求3所述的方法,其特征在于,所述预设镜像列表还包括所述预设镜像标识对应的预设资产数据;所述从预设镜像列表中获取已知节点的第一资产数据的步骤包括:
在所述预设镜像列表中确定出与所述已知镜像标识匹配的选定预设镜像标识;
从所述预设镜像列表获取与所述选定预设镜像标识对应的选定预设资产数据;
基于所述选定预设资产数据,获得所述第一资产数据。


5.如权利要求4所述的方法,其特征在于,所述对所述未知镜像标识对应的未知节点进行资产探测,以获得第二资产数据的步骤之后,所述方法还包括:
建立所述未知镜像标识与所述第二资产数据的映射关系;

【专利技术属性】
技术研发人员:罗翠王海燕杨树强陶莎李润恒
申请(专利权)人:鹏城实验室
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1